Map DLC and Season Pass Please Hear me out!

Ok so this happens to every game that has ever been like this whether they we're from EA or whatever. Particularly Battlefield 3 and 4 this happened to me. I've always loved the series so I would spend extra money for the dlc or season passes. However after spending this money and a certainly know I'm not the only one. Realize it was basically a waste because not enough people ever have the map packs.  Especially a few years in. For BF3/4 there are maps I've never stepped foot in and I paid for them! So it's kinda like you rip people off. I'm not asking for a refund or anything. It's just that at the very least give the maps out for free after a certain time frame. If anything do it for the people that actually bought them. I'm telling you I would always still buy the maps so I could play on them right away so you would still get your money. Furthermore when this happens it cuts down on the life span of a game. After a while it gets lame to play on the same old maps over and over. You know you always have servers for rent so you lose money when people stop renting them. I would rent a server for bf4 and include all the dlc maps but I don't. Reason being is because some server owners practically beg people to buy the maps so they themselves would be able to enjoy them. Nobody does because of things like this so you're not making money on them anyway. I know you would be able to make more money on the older games.     @ChugKendall You misunderstood his post.

    It's not a paid subscription just to play the game. The paid Season Passes are mainly just cosmetics while the stuff that effects gameplay such as New Maps and New Weapons will be FREE for everyone who owns the game itself.
